-
Ruby 通过 FTP 下载文件
所属栏目:[百科] 日期:2020-12-17 热度:59
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'net/ftp'ftp = Net::FTP.new('ftp.ruby-lang.org')ftp.passive = trueftp.loginftp.chdir('/pub/ruby/1.8')ftp.getbinaryfile('1.8.2-patch1[详细]
-
石头剪刀布ruby版
所属栏目:[百科] 日期:2020-12-17 热度:142
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 #encoding: utf-8arr = ['石头','剪刀','布']win_arr = [['石头','剪刀'],['剪刀','布'],['布','石头']]#随机computer的值,放入result数组中result =[详细]
-
Ruby 访问 CGI 变量
所属栏目:[百科] 日期:2020-12-17 热度:144
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 #!/usr/bin/rubyrequire 'cgi'cgi = CGI.newtext = cgi['text']puts cgi.headerputs "htmlbody#{text.reverse}/body/html" 以上是编程之家(jb51.cc)为[详细]
-
Combination Finder
所属栏目:[百科] 日期:2020-12-17 热度:78
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 def factorial(n) if n==0 return 1 else return n*factorial(n-1) endenddef combination(x,y) if yx puts "Invalid Input!" else result=factorial([详细]
-
Ruby 改变 SSH 上的当前目录
所属栏目:[百科] 日期:2020-12-17 热度:170
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'rubygems'require 'net/ssh'Net::SSH.start('example.com',:username='yourName',:password='mypass') do |session| shell = session.shell.[详细]
-
Ruby策略模式2
所属栏目:[百科] 日期:2020-12-17 热度:119
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 class Formatter def output_report title,text raise 'can not call Abstract method' end end class HTMLFormatter Formatter def output_report ti[详细]
-
Ruby 仿 C 结构体:CStruct 的一些例子
所属栏目:[百科] 日期:2020-12-17 热度:184
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 # CStruct Examplesrequire 'cstruct'# example:# struct Point in CC++ (32-bit platform): ## struct Point# {# int x;# int y;# }; # struct Poin[详细]
-
Ruby调用WindowsAPI模拟按键
所属栏目:[百科] 日期:2020-12-17 热度:145
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'win32api'class KeyBoardHelper attr_reader :ctrl,:shift,:alt,:win def initialize @ctrl,@shift,@alt,@win = 0x11,0x10,0x12,0x5b @bScan[详细]
-
Android Tips
所属栏目:[百科] 日期:2020-12-17 热度:52
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 attr_accessor :tag_list 以上是编程之家(jb51.cc)为你收集整理的全部代码内容,希望文章能够帮你解决所遇到的程序开发问题。 如果觉得编程之家网站内[详细]
-
判断一个数是否为质数
所属栏目:[百科] 日期:2020-12-17 热度:65
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 def prime?(num) res = [1] res num if num == 0 || num == 1 return false end 2.upto(10) do |x| #如果有自己的话,就跳下一次循环 if num == x next[详细]
-
正则表达式来解析Ruby的日志消息
所属栏目:[百科] 日期:2020-12-17 热度:60
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 # parse ruby log message# customize as neededLOG_EXPRESSION = /([w]+),s+[([^]s]+)s+#([^]]+)]s+(w+)s+--s+(w+)?:s+(.+)/# sample l[详细]
-
Rails 连接到 MySQL 数据库
所属栏目:[百科] 日期:2020-12-17 热度:192
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require "rubygems"require "activerecord"ActiveRecord::Base.establish_connection( :adapter = "mysql",:host = "localhost",:username = "root",:[详细]
-
Ruby 使用 HTTPS
所属栏目:[百科] 日期:2020-12-17 热度:68
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'net/http'require 'net/https'url = URI.parse('https://example.com/')http = Net::HTTP.new(url.host,url.port)http.use_ssl = true if ur[详细]
-
Ruby 使用 POST 方法提交数据: set_form_data
所属栏目:[百科] 日期:2020-12-17 热度:75
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'net/http'url = URI.parse('http://www.rubyinside.com/test.cgi')Net::HTTP.start(url.host,url.port) do |http| req = Net::HTTP::Post.ne[详细]
-
去掉 升级rubygems1.80后的warn
所属栏目:[百科] 日期:2020-12-17 热度:105
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 module Deprecate def self.skip # :nodoc: #@skip ||= false #update by jazz 2011-5-6 true end def self.skip= v # :nodoc: #@skip = v #update by[详细]
-
替换歌词里的时间为空白
所属栏目:[百科] 日期:2020-12-17 热度:153
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 f=File.open('M0030002007.lrc')f.each do |line| puts line.gsub(/[[d:.]]/,'')end 以上是编程之家(jb51.cc)为你收集整理的全部代码内容,希望文[详细]
-
删除目录中重复的文件
所属栏目:[百科] 日期:2020-12-17 热度:146
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'find'require 'digest/md5'uniqueFileTable = Hash.newsameFileTable = Hash.new#puts ARGV[0]directory = ARGV[0]#.encode("UTF-8")def hav[详细]
-
Ruby 在 Excel 中插入图表并进行旋转
所属栏目:[百科] 日期:2020-12-17 热度:133
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'win32ole' ChartTypeVal = 4100; excel = WIN32OLE.new("excel.application") excel['Visible'] = TRUE excel.Workbooks.Add() excel.Range([详细]
-
ActiveRecord中动态读取表中字段的方法
所属栏目:[百科] 日期:2020-12-17 热度:182
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 script/console Loading development environment (Rails 2.3.11) p = Package.new= #Package id: nil,name: nil,build: nil,notes: nil,user_id: nil[详细]
-
Ruby 抓取 URL 的内容
所属栏目:[百科] 日期:2020-12-17 热度:65
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'open-uri'puts open('http://www.oschina.net/').read(200) 以上是编程之家(jb51.cc)为你收集整理的全部代码内容,希望文章能够帮你解决所遇[详细]
-
filter_parameter_logging方法
所属栏目:[百科] 日期:2020-12-17 热度:197
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 filter_parameter_logging :password,:password_confirmation 以上是编程之家(jb51.cc)为你收集整理的全部代码内容,希望文章能够帮你解决所遇到的程[详细]
-
Ruby 编写 CGI 脚本
所属栏目:[百科] 日期:2020-12-17 热度:56
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 #!/usr/bin/ruby print "Content-type: text/htmlrnrn" print "htmlbodyHello World! It's #{Time.now}/body/htmlrn" 以上是编程之家(jb51.cc)[详细]
-
Ruby批量执行Linux安装程序和脚本
所属栏目:[百科] 日期:2020-12-17 热度:74
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'find' module Find def match(*paths) matched = [] find(*paths) { |path| matched path if yield path } return matched end module_funct[详细]
-
Rails 之 Model 简单一例
所属栏目:[百科] 日期:2020-12-17 热度:181
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 class Cruncher def crunch return 5 endend 以上是编程之家(jb51.cc)为你收集整理的全部代码内容,希望文章能够帮你解决所遇到的程序开发问题。 如果[详细]
-
爬取指定页面链连
所属栏目:[百科] 日期:2020-12-17 热度:136
今天PHP站长网 52php.cn把收集自互联网的代码分享给大家,仅供参考。 require 'rubygems'require 'open-uri'url_hash = {}open('http://www.cnblogs.com/TomXu/archive/2011/12/15/2288411.html').each do |i| if i =~ /([详细]